Three concentric spherical metallic shells JC, Y and Z of radius a, b and c respectively [a < b < c] have surface charge densities σ, -σ and σ, respectively. The shells X and Z are at same potential. If the radii of X & Y are 2 cm and 3 cm, respectively. The radius of shell Z is_____cm.
